The laurel processing plant Black Sea Laurus has suspended exports to Ukraine due to hostilities.

Mikheil Melua, a representative of the company, told bm.ge that Black Sea Laurus sold 12 tons of laurels in Ukraine this year. According to him, the process of negotiations with China to diversify the market has been underway, but is suspended due to the tense situation.

"We started the negotiation process with China, but now it has stopped. It is difficult for us to make preliminary predictions, we planned to process 400 tons of laurel this year, but given the current situation, we do not know how we will be able to find key markets. We will not discuss exports to Russia, everyone has cut ties and we are not going to start negotiations with Russia," said Mikheil Melua.
